Scott Porter Joins Rachel Bilson in Hart Of Dixie

What has Rachel Bilson been up to these days? You’ll remember the breezy waif from The O.C. in her role as Summer. Well, the actress filmed two episodes of the comedy How I Met Your Mother in 2010 and her little known romantic film, Waiting for Forever, hit theaters last month. Now the brunette is gearing up for a return to television.

The pilot, in development for the CW network, is called Hart of Dixie. TV Line likens it to Everwood. In it, Bilson plays “Zoe, a young New York City doctor who inherits a medical practice in a small Southern town inhabited by an eclectic group of characters.” That DOES sound like Everwood, a show I definitely miss. The great news is the actor who portrays Kalinda’s rival investigator on The Good Wife, the masterful Scott Porter, is also attached to the pilot in a leading role. While Zoe is the main character, Porter has been cast as “a longtime resident of the sleepy town who develops an intense connection with Bilson’s MD. Too bad he’s engaged to the daughter of Zoe’s chief rival at the medical practice.” I can’t help but report the last adorable connection to Everwood that TV Line made when they wrote, “He’s the Nina to Bilson’s Andy!” And fans will recall Nina and Andy didn’t end up together until the final season of that CW drama.
